Hey how bout that scene where bruce is talking with alfred about needing to sneak into lex's compound and alfred tells him he can just go there as bruce wayne since he's been invited to the party.

You know what follows right afterwards? A shot of bruce looking intently at the batman suit and then going to the party. In the movie it serves no purpose and even makes it worse because it seems like bruce was considering going as batman anyway even though it was just established that going as bruce wayne is a better plan.

As for why that shot is in the movie, it's because it's from TDKR comic where bruce is contemplating taking up the mantle of batman again. It holds significance to the story as the moment batman returns, its a character moment of bruce determining that his life isn't as important as gotham city and its an iconic moment in batman's history as helping define the character, showing that without the batman persona bruce is an empty husk of a man

Now all of this flies over the head of our director zack snyder. Batman has already returned in this movie months ago, and its not a moment of decision for him, since batman isn't even needed at the moment. Snyder only put the shot in because it looked cool; he fundamentally missed the point of that moment in the comic and shows time and time again, he doesn't understand these characters
